Children's Theatre Company (CTC) is delighted to announce the complete cast and creative team for the CTC-commissioned new musical Milo Imagines the World, which will run from February 4-March 9, 2025 on the UnitedHealth Group Stage.
Based on the book by Matt de la Peña and Christian Robinson, Milo Imagines the World features a book by Terry Guest, with music and lyrics by Christian Albright and Christian Magby. The production is directed by Mikael Burke, with music direction by Sanford Moore, and choreography by Breon Arzell. Milo Imagines the World is a joint commission by The Rose Theater (Omaha, Nebraska), Chicago Children's Theatre (Chicago, Illinois), and Children's Theatre Company (Minneapolis, Minnesota).

On a crowded subway, Milo passes the time imagining the lives of the other passengers. See his illustrations brought to spirited life in this world-premiere musical, featuring dynamic new songs ranging from hip hop and pop to country. Ride along with Milo from stop to stop as he begins to understand that first impressions aren't always accurate, that his older sister Adrienne isn't always annoying, and that real life can sometimes be even more incredible than an imaginary one.

Children's Theatre Company (CTC) is the nation's largest and most acclaimed theatre for young people and serves a multigenerational audience. It creates theatre experiences that educate, challenge, and inspire more than 200,000 people annually. CTC is the only theatre focused on young audiences to win the Special Tony Award for Outstanding Regional Theatre and is the only theatre in Minnesota to receive three Tony nominations (for its production of A Year With Frog and Toad). CTC is committed to creating world-class productions at the highest level and to developing new works, more than 200 to date, dramatically changing the canon of work for young audiences.
CTC is the most significant provider of theatre education opportunities in the region. Every year, thousands of children experience theatre for the first time at CTC.
